A roller door can look suitable on the day it is installed yet become expensive if its material does not match the site. This roller door materials comparison explains how aluminium, steel, Zincalume and stainless steel differ in strength, weight, corrosion resistance, maintenance and cost. The right answer depends on your location, opening and security needs, not one material name.

Why the curtain material changes more than appearance

The curtain is the moving surface that rolls around the drum above the opening. Its material affects the door’s weight, impact resistance and response to moisture.

A heavier curtain can require different springs, brackets and motor capacity. A material that performs well inland may also need more care near salt spray.

However, the metal alone does not determine security. A thin steel curtain with weak guides may perform worse than a properly designed aluminium system. Compare the slat profile, thickness, guides, locks and fasteners as one assembly.

Cost needs the same full-system approach. Include the finish, motor, installation, cleaning and possible corrosion repairs. The cheapest curtain can produce a higher ownership cost if it needs frequent repainting or early replacement.

Aluminium roller doors

Aluminium develops a protective oxide layer when exposed to air. It does not form the red iron oxide commonly called rust. Anodising or powder coating can provide further protection and colour.

Its low weight can reduce the load placed on the door’s springs and operator. This makes aluminium useful for frequently operated doors, although the finished door must still be weighed and matched to a suitable motor.

Aluminium is not automatically a light-duty choice. Extruded, double-wall and reinforced profiles can provide substantial strength. However, thin aluminium can dent under vehicle, trolley or deliberate impact.

Choose aluminium when low weight, appearance and resistance to humid air matter. Ask for the alloy, profile, wall thickness, finish and maximum approved opening size.

Steel roller doors

Carbon steel is widely used because it is strong, readily formed and usually economical. It can suit garages, shops, warehouses and industrial openings where impact resistance and security are priorities.

Bare carbon steel can rust when moisture and oxygen reach it. Manufacturers manage this risk through galvanising, metallic coatings, paint or powder coating. Any protective system needs careful handling because scratches and damaged edges can become corrosion points.

Steel curtains are generally heavier than comparable aluminium curtains. That weight affects the barrel, springs, guides and motor. It can also make manual operation less convenient.

Choose steel where security, impact resistance or a large opening carries more weight than minimum maintenance. Confirm the steel thickness, coating, finish and repair process for scratches.

Zincalume roller doors

Zincalume is not solid zinc or a separate structural metal. It is steel protected by a metallic alloy coating. A traditional regional specification uses 55% aluminium, 43.5% zinc and 1.5% silicon in the coating.

The steel core provides strength. The aluminium-rich portion creates barrier protection, while zinc helps protect exposed areas sacrificially. Product formulations and coating masses can vary, so the brand name alone is not a complete specification.

Zincalume can be a practical middle option for sheds, commercial properties and industrial doors. It normally offers better weather resistance than bare or lightly protected steel without the cost of stainless steel.

It still needs inspection. Cut edges, deep scratches, incompatible fasteners and surfaces sheltered from rain can deteriorate. Severe coastal exposure also requires confirmation from the supplier rather than a general corrosion claim.

Stainless steel roller doors

Stainless steel contains enough chromium to form a protective passive film. Grade selection affects how well that film resists a particular environment.

Grade 304 may suit many indoor or mild settings. Grade 316 or 316L is often specified for coastal land-based applications because it provides better resistance to chloride-related pitting.

Stainless steel is valuable in food processing, health care and other sites that require regular cleaning. It can also suit premium coastal or industrial projects where downtime and corrosion costs are high.

It is not completely stain-free. Salt deposits, rough finishes, fabrication contamination and crevices can cause brown tea staining or local corrosion. Correct fabrication, smooth finishes and cleaning remain necessary.

Match the material to Sri Lanka’s conditions

Sri Lanka receives about 2,000 millimetres of rain in an average year. High humidity, monsoon rain and coastal salt can expose a door to moisture for long periods.

For an inland residential garage, coated steel or Zincalume may offer a sensible balance of cost and strength. Aluminium can reduce maintenance and provide a clean finish where moderate impact resistance is sufficient.

For a coastal home or shop, aluminium or correctly graded stainless steel deserves consideration. Coated steel may still work, but its suitability depends on the coating system, distance from salt water and cleaning schedule.

Busy warehouses need a different calculation. Opening size, vehicle impact, wind exposure and operating cycles may make a heavy-duty steel or coated-steel system more suitable. Stainless steel may justify its price where aggressive chemicals, hygiene rules or costly downtime are present.

Check the entire door for compatibility. An aluminium curtain attached to unsuitable steel fasteners can create a local corrosion problem even when the main curtain remains sound.

Avoid these expensive material mistakes

Do not accept “steel,” “aluminium” or “stainless” as a complete specification. Ask for the grade, thickness, slat profile, coating and finish in writing.

Avoid choosing by curtain price alone. The quotation should identify the motor, manual release, guides, brackets, safety controls, installation, warranty and maintenance requirements.

Do not assume corrosion resistance means maintenance-free. Remove salt and dirt, keep drainage paths open and inspect coating damage. Sheltered surfaces may need manual washing because rain cannot clean them.

Avoid mixing metals without compatible fasteners, coatings or isolating barriers. Ask the supplier how the design controls galvanic corrosion.

Finally, do not use a light domestic specification for a busy commercial opening. Frequent cycles, wide spans and impact risks require a door designed for that duty.

Use five questions to make the final decision

Ask these questions before requesting a final quotation:

  • How much salt, rain, humidity or chemical exposure reaches the door?
  • What security and impact resistance does the complete assembly provide?
  • Is the curtain approved for the opening size and local wind conditions?
  • How many times will the door operate each day?
  • What will cleaning, servicing and coating repairs cost over its life?

Choose aluminium for low weight, design flexibility and strong resistance to humid conditions. Choose coated steel when strength and price are the main priorities. Choose Zincalume when you need steel performance with better metallic coating protection. Consider grade 316 stainless steel for demanding coastal, hygiene-sensitive or corrosive sites.

Frequently asked questions

Which roller door material is best for coastal areas?
Aluminium or correctly specified grade 316 stainless steel is often the safest starting point for coastal sites. The final choice should consider direct salt exposure, impact risk, budget and cleaning access. Coated steel requires verified coastal suitability and regular inspection for damaged finishes.
Is Zincalume better than ordinary steel for roller doors?
Zincalume usually provides better corrosion protection than bare or lightly painted carbon steel because it is steel with an aluminium-zinc alloy coating. Performance still depends on coating mass, cut-edge protection, compatible fasteners, exposure and maintenance, so buyers should request the complete specification.
Is aluminium secure enough for a garage or shop?
Aluminium can provide strong security when the complete door is properly designed. Profile thickness, reinforcement, guide depth, locks and installation matter more than the metal name alone. High-impact warehouses may still benefit from heavy-duty steel, while reinforced aluminium can suit many homes and shops.
